Transaction ffbef79fcca96e2a50f1763d5e313fc7d5e177a8a4569b536643b3891d071351
4 Input
2 Outputs
- ffbef79fcca96e2a50f1763d5e313fc7d5e177a8a4569b536643b3891d071351:0
- ffbef79fcca96e2a50f1763d5e313fc7d5e177a8a4569b536643b3891d071351:1
value 567062
address 1EGPCGA6CBNAMWWnovPT2ayPBitw9a3KnJ
value 3378088
address 1JzXEwF4Gm7JkdWNzctmLt4zT99Uiv1aft